A Barrington house dating to the late 1800s is getting ready to take a ride.
Restaurateur Mark Hoffmann closed a deal last month for the former Wool Street Grill and Sports Bar, which will be converted into Moretti’s Ristorante and Pizzeria, and for the historic house and land next door. Moretti’s is expected to open this year.
Instead of razing the 118 Wool St. home for Moretti’s parking, Hoffmann said he has donated it to Barrington Hills documentary filmmaker Jeff Baustert, who plans to move it to his family’s property for use as a guesthouse. Workers preparing for the move were on the home’s property Thursday.
Under a tentative plan, the house was to take off from Wool and Station streets at 5:15 a.m. Sunday for an estimated 7½-hour, 3-mile trip west to Barrington Hills. But village officials said Thursday the house, dating to sometime in the 1870s, now is expected to be transported in July.
